extractive

/ɛksˈtræktɪv/

Definitions

1. adjective

relating to or based on the extraction of natural resources, especially minerals or fossil fuels.

“The extractive industry has a significant impact on the environment.”

2. noun

an economy based on the extraction of natural resources.

“The extractive economy of the country relies heavily on oil exports.”
